Transaction 91ab8c7789b882a91b8547c8efc8a117c1de16beb050eacdb4cbf8e19457d87e
1 Input
1 Output
-
91ab8c7789b882a91b8547c8efc8a117c1de16beb050eacdb4cbf8e19457d87e:0
- value
- 2566576
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f710766678fb8178cf40da719f327cdb0124286e OP_EQUAL
- address
- 3QDNYm4ZnRrtTQvZTQvQ47xysDuGpyuzxy